Hazmat alarm at detention center finds no hazard, Westminster MD

According to the dispatch call, emergency responders investigated a hazmat alarm at Carroll County Detention Center near North Court Street due to an odor of bleach and cleaner. Carbon monoxide levels were measured at 6 parts per million. No significant hazards were found, and ventilation was performed.
